Output e03bd6a7150148256273a0744a5c966c15b25fd6034c092607759fb31c7794ea:0

value
67000
script pubkey
OP_0 OP_PUSHBYTES_20 21e65766f8a2f168c29ccfe620a3049ee4b1af69
address
bc1qy8n9wehc5tck3s5uelnzpgcynmjtrtmffrh64f
transaction
e03bd6a7150148256273a0744a5c966c15b25fd6034c092607759fb31c7794ea
spent
true